Unix Man (Справочное руководство)


ENVIRON(7) - часть 2


Jn основан на июльском дне n n основан на июльском дне n Wn.d n 0-ый день недели d Mm.n.d n-ый день недели d в месяце m

Например:

EST5:00:00DT4:00:00;M4.1.0/2:00:00,M10.5.0/2:00:00.

ссылается на tz(7) страницу, введенную вручную, для для большего в TZ. HZ Определяет с численным значением число временных прерываний. Значения этой переменной зависит от технического обеспечения и создано в файле etc/default/login. Если HZ не определен, программы, зависящие от данного значения в герцах, такие как и 0, не будут вычисляться. LANG Определяет область действия языка, с которым хочет работать пользователь. Эта переменная может быть запрошена с применениями и утилитами для определения того, как выводить информацию на экран; какой язык использовать для сообщений, для определения порядка сортировки и других функций, зависящих от языка.

Среда может быть изменена с помощью присваивания нового значения переменной. Для командного процессора Bourne, , присваивание имеет вид:

name=value

Например, присваивание:

TERM=h29

присваивает переменной Т значение "h29". Новое значение может быть "экспортировано" каждому последовательному вызову командного процессора с помощью экспортирования переменной с командой export (смотри ) или используя .

Пользователи командного С-процессора выполняют присваивание с помощью команды setenv. Например:

setenv TERM h29

Для более полной информации смотрите .

Пользователь может также добавить переменную к среде, но он должен быть уверен, что новые имена совместимы с экспортированными именами командного процессора, такими как MAIL, PS1, PS2 и IFS. Помещение аргументов в файл .profile полезно для того, чтобы автоматически изменить среду перед началом работы.

Отметим, что среда делается доступной для всех программ как строка массивов. Каждая строка имеет вид:

name=value

где name - имя экспортируемой переменной, и value 3 - текущее значение переменной. Для программ, начинающихся с вызова , среда доступна с помощью внешнего указателя environ. Для других программ собственные переменные среды доступны через вызовы getenv.

СМ. ТАКЖЕ


, , , getenv(2), login(7), , , tz(7)




Начало  Назад  Вперед